The drilling effect of complex and weak coal seams is of great significance for gas extraction in mines. A ZDY6000LR high-speed tracked drilling rig with high rotational speed, high power, and high torque performance was designed to address the problems of difficult slag removal, high accident rate, and hole formation during the drilling construction of complex and weak coal seams in Wangpo Coal Mine. The maximum torque was 6 000 N·m and the maximum speed was 400 r/min. The layout, power head, angle adjustment mechanism, feed body, and hydraulic system of the drilling rig were optimized to ensure that the problems such as sticking and collapsing during the drilling process can be effectively solved during the construction process.
